Mitch Johnson's coaching success stems from his ability to adapt and innovate. When he was unexpectedly appointed as head coach after Greg Popovich transitioned to the front office, Johnson faced the challenge of maintaining the Spurs' culture while ushering in a new era. The team's front office made a bold move in the 2025 NBA Draft, selecting Dylan Harper, which created a complex roster dynamic with multiple talented guards. Johnson experimented with various lineups, enabling each guard to contribute effectively. This strategic approach allowed players to flourish individually while contributing to the team's overall success. The Spurs improved significantly, climbing to the second seed in the West after a decent performance the previous year. His emphasis on individual player growth, as seen with Castle and Harper, didn't hinder the team's dominance. Johnson's achievements make him a top candidate for Coach of the Year, potentially ending a drought for the Spurs since Popovich's win in 2014.
